You've probably been told to feel your emotions. But what if you're already feeling too much?
Some people avoid the emotion completely. Others feel so much, it becomes reactive, and they'll say, "but I am feeling. I feel everything."
There's a difference between feeling an emotion and being in the reaction of it.
Try replacing "feel it" with "acknowledge it." Because even when you're already feeling everything, there can still be resistance underneath it, thoughts like "what's wrong with me" or "I shouldn't feel this way." That's still resistance.
The emotion doesn't need more feeling. It needs to be acknowledged.
